AudioSolver is a free, privacy-first audio testing and hardware diagnostic suite designed to test, calibrate, and troubleshoot computer and smartphone audio hardware directly inside the web browser.
Unlike legacy audio testing websites that run intrusive ads, require browser plugins, or stream audio recordings to remote servers, AudioSolver runs 100% client-side using native Web Audio and MediaStream APIs. Your voice, ambient noise, and microphone audio never leave your device.

Client-Side Processing
Runs 100% locally via Web Audio API with zero audio uploaded or stored.
Microphone Diagnostics
Real-time volume meter, noise floor analysis, clipping detection, and latency feedback.
Stereo Speaker Test
Left, Right, and Center channel isolation, balance check, and acoustic phase testing.
Tone Generator & Water Eject
20 Hz to 20,000 Hz frequency sweeps and acoustic pulses for moisture removal.
